• Home
  • Raw
  • Download

Lines Matching refs:_ext

157     statp->_u._ext.nscount = 0;  in res_vinit()
158 statp->_u._ext.ext = (res_state_ext*) malloc(sizeof(*statp->_u._ext.ext)); in res_vinit()
160 if (statp->_u._ext.ext != NULL) { in res_vinit()
161 memset(statp->_u._ext.ext, 0, sizeof(*statp->_u._ext.ext)); in res_vinit()
162 statp->_u._ext.ext->nsaddrs[0].sin = statp->nsaddr; in res_vinit()
163 strcpy(statp->_u._ext.ext->nsuffix, "ip6.arpa"); in res_vinit()
164 strcpy(statp->_u._ext.ext->nsuffix2, "ip6.int"); in res_vinit()
205 res_state_ext* ext = statp->_u._ext.ext; in res_setoptions()
287 for (ns = 0; ns < statp->_u._ext.nscount; ns++) { in res_nclose()
288 if (statp->_u._ext.nssocks[ns] != -1) { in res_nclose()
289 (void) close(statp->_u._ext.nssocks[ns]); in res_nclose()
290 statp->_u._ext.nssocks[ns] = -1; in res_nclose()
297 if (statp->_u._ext.ext != NULL) free(statp->_u._ext.ext); in res_ndestroy()
299 statp->_u._ext.ext = NULL; in res_ndestroy()
310 statp->_u._ext.nscount = 0; in res_setservers()
317 if (statp->_u._ext.ext) in res_setservers()
318 memcpy(&statp->_u._ext.ext->nsaddrs[nserv], &set->sin, size); in res_setservers()
329 if (statp->_u._ext.ext) in res_setservers()
330 memcpy(&statp->_u._ext.ext->nsaddrs[nserv], &set->sin6, size); in res_setservers()
353 if (statp->_u._ext.ext) in res_getservers()
354 family = statp->_u._ext.ext->nsaddrs[i].sin.sin_family; in res_getservers()
361 if (statp->_u._ext.ext) in res_getservers()
362 memcpy(&set->sin, &statp->_u._ext.ext->nsaddrs[i], size); in res_getservers()
370 if (statp->_u._ext.ext) in res_getservers()
371 memcpy(&set->sin6, &statp->_u._ext.ext->nsaddrs[i], size); in res_getservers()